Robert M.
di Scipio
is the founder of ePals, Inc. (1996).
He held the title of Director from 1996 to 2011.
Mr. di Scipio is also the founder of Skyland Analytics, Inc. He is currently a Director at Sinopsys Surgical, Inc. Mr. di Scipio's former positions include President, Chief Executive Officer & Director at Aegis Analytical Corp.
(2012-2013), Director at BaroFold, Inc., Director-New Business Development at TMP Worldwide, Inc., Associate General Counsel at Martek Biosciences Corp., Attorney at Coopers & Lybrand LLP, General Counsel & Secretary at Martek Biosciences Boulder Corp., and Managing Partner at HCORP Holdings Ltd.
Mr. di Scipio received a graduate degree from Pace University and an undergraduate degree from the University of Michigan.
